Mariana Zobel de Ayala, the former head of Bank of the Philippine Islands (BPI) Consumer Bank Marketing and Digital Platforms and now head of Ayala Malls Leasing and Hospitality, recently visited a BPI partner store, Prince Stores Gun-ob in Lapu-Lapu, Cebu. This visit underscores the Ayala Group’s dedication to advancing financial inclusion through innovative partnerships and accessible banking solutions.

Mariana Zobel de Ayala experiences the convenience of BPI’s newest deposit and withdrawal services at Prince Stores, highlighting the partnership’s commitment to bringing accessible banking closer to communities. 

The collaboration between Ayala Corporation and BPI aims to bridge gaps in financial services by working with trusted retail networks like Prince Stores. These partnerships enable underserved communities to seamlessly access essential banking services.

“Ayala Group remains steadfast in fostering inclusivity across industries we operate in. BPI exemplifies this mission by establishing innovative partnerships, such as with Prince Stores, to deliver exceptional banking services to all Filipinos, wherever they are,” said Zobel de Ayala.

Through its Agency Banking segment, BPI has partnered with Prince Stores to serve as a cash agent, allowing customers to apply for BPI products, as well as deposit and withdraw cash at store locations. This integration of banking services into the shopping experience offers greater convenience, especially for customers in underserved areas.

To further engage customers, BPI and Prince Stores launched the on-going “Naay BPI Diri” (“May BPI Dito”) raffle promo. Customers who use BPI services at Prince Stores stand a chance to win exciting prizes, including three Yamaha NMAX motorcycles and in-store shopping sprees worth PHP 50,000 each.
